Former Asante Kotoko Forward Dauda Mohammed came off the bench to make his European debut for Belgium giants RSC Anderlecht as his side played a 2-2 drawn game at the Constant Vanden Stock Stadium against Dede Ayew’s Fernabache.
Dauda was introduced in the 86th minute to replace Pieters Gerkens to mark his Europa League debut for the Belgium outfit.
Anderlecht took two goals lead through Zakaria Bakkali in the 35th and 49th minutes respectively before Michael Frey and Hassan Ali Kaldirim ended the thrilling tie all square.
Anderlecht and Fenerbahce were expected to challenge for qualification, but now face-off in a must-win encounter after both making poor starts.
The 19-year-old joined the Purple and White lads from Asante Kotoko last year but had to bid for his chance in the club's youth set-up.

The prolific hitman hit the headlines prior to the second half of the campaign with his scoring prowess for the U21 side and was touted to make the grade in the first team by coach Hein Vanhaezebrouk.
